nubia unveils Neo 5 5G gaming phones, intros Neoverse platform

Gaming smartphone brand nubia has launched its Neoverse platform alongside the new Neo 5 5G series, as the company pushes to expand its presence in the growing mobile gaming market.

The Neo 5 lineup includes three models — the Neo 5 GT, Neo 5 Pro, and the entry-level Neo 5 — positioned for a range of users from competitive gamers to casual players.

The company said the devices are designed to make gaming-focused features more accessible.

The launch comes as mobile gaming continues to expand globally, with industry estimates placing the number of players at around 3 billion in 2025.

The Neo 5 series features gaming-oriented hardware such as shoulder trigger buttons, high-refresh-rate displays, and cooling systems aimed at sustained performance.

nubia said the devices support a 515Hz response rate through its NeoTriggers 5.0, along with displays reaching up to 144Hz and peak brightness of up to 4,500 nits. The phones also include AI-based gaming assistance features.

Prices for the devices range from P11,999 for the base Neo 5 5G to P17,990 for the Neo 5 GT.

The nubia Neo 5 GT 5G

“Nubia’s overarching vision is to deliver championship-level gaming experiences to everyone, combining top performance, innovative features, and accessible pricing,” the company said.

The company also introduced its Neoverse platform during the event, positioning it as part of a broader push to build a gaming-focused ecosystem.

Partnerships highlighted during the launch included collaborations with Tianlala and Geely.
